Solution for 5x+6x-14+3=0 equation:


Simplifying
5x + 6x + -14 + 3 = 0

Reorder the terms:
-14 + 3 + 5x + 6x = 0

Combine like terms: -14 + 3 = -11
-11 + 5x + 6x = 0

Combine like terms: 5x + 6x = 11x
-11 + 11x = 0

Solving
-11 + 11x = 0

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'11' to each side of the equation.
-11 + 11 + 11x = 0 + 11

Combine like terms: -11 + 11 = 0
0 + 11x = 0 + 11
11x = 0 + 11

Combine like terms: 0 + 11 = 11
11x = 11

Divide each side by '11'.
x = 1

Simplifying
x = 1
